Kanchanaparu Population - Koraput, Orissa

Kanchanaparu is a medium size village located in Narayanpatana Block of Koraput district, Orissa with total 51 families residing. The Kanchanaparu village has population of 216 of which 102 are males while 114 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kanchanaparu village population of children with age 0-6 is 34 which makes up 15.74 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kanchanaparu village is 1118 which is higher than Orissa state average of 979. Child Sex Ratio for the Kanchanaparu as per census is 1000, higher than Orissa average of 941.

Kanchanaparu village has lower literacy rate compared to Orissa. In 2011, literacy rate of Kanchanaparu village was 35.71 % compared to 72.87 % of Orissa. In Kanchanaparu Male literacy stands at 48.24 % while female literacy rate was 24.74 %.

Caste Factor

In Kanchanaparu village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 100.00 % of total population in Kanchanaparu village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Kanchanaparu village of Koraput.

Work Profile

In Kanchanaparu village out of total population, 115 were engaged in work activities. 76.52 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 23.48 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 115 workers engaged in Main Work, 87 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
